A brand new research has revealed which Oregon campgrounds campers beloved most in 2025 based mostly on 1000’s of customer critiques.

Camping useful resource and app Camp Chimp analyzed suggestions posted on Recreation.gov to find out the highest-rated campgrounds throughout the state. Using AI to evaluation camper experiences from 2025, the corporate ranked Oregon’s high locations to pitch a tent, park an RV or spend an evening outdoor.  

Here’s the place Oregon’s campgrounds landed within the rankings, in accordance with the report.

What are the perfect campgrounds in Oregon?

Here had been the highest 10 campgrounds in Oregon, in accordance with Camp Chimp:

10. Ice Cap

Ice Cap Campground is situated within the Willamette National Forest off the McKenzie Highway in Linn County.

Campers appreciated the campground’s giant, personal tenting spots and proximity to mountaineering trails and waterfalls.

It has 22 campsites, with 9 walk-in-only tent websites and two double vault restrooms within the heart of the campground. Visitors can discover picnic tables, grills and campfire rings at every website.

Carmen Reservoir and the McKenzie River National Recreation Trail and river are close by, offering guests with alternatives for mountaineering, biking, swimming, boating, fishing and sightseeing. There can be a three-mile path that loops previous Koosah Falls and Sahalie Falls.

Ice Cap is open from May 15 to Oct. 10, and nightly charges start at $25. It obtained 4.69 out of 5 stars based mostly on 13 camper critiques in 2025, in accordance with Camp Chimp.

9. Cavitt Creek Falls

Cavitt Creek Recreation Site is situated on the fringe of the Umpqua National Forest close to Glide.

Campers appreciated that the campground was well-kept and the close by waterfall. It options 10 campsites nestled amongst fir, maple and cedar timber, providing picnic tables, grills and close by consuming water and vault restrooms. Visitors can benefit from the swimming gap that sits on the base of a 6-foot waterfall on Cavitt Creek.

Cavitt Creek Falls is open from May 15 to Nov. 15, and nightly charges start at $14. It obtained 4.71 out of 5 stars based mostly on 17 camper critiques in 2025, in accordance with Camp Chimp.

8. Quinn Meadow Horse Camp

Quinn Meadow Horse Camp is discovered inside central Oregon’s Deschutes National Forest close to Bend.

Campers appreciated that the campground featured facilities for each human guests and horses. It options double or quadruple corrals and horse stalls, an on-site manure pit and watering gap and a picnic shelter. Campsites additionally provide tables, hearth rings, giant parking areas and close by vault restrooms and consuming water.

Quinn Creek Trail begins within the campground and follows the trail alongside Hosmer Lake, main into the Metolius-Windigo Trail, which is greater than 100 miles lengthy.

Quinn Meadow Horse Camp is open from May 1 to Sept. 26, and nightly charges start at $25. It obtained 4.71 out of 5 stars based mostly on 14 camper critiques in 2025, in accordance with Camp Chimp.

7. Nottingham

Nottingham Campground is situated inside the Mt. Hood National Forest.

The campground options 21 campsites situated alongside the Hood River. Many websites are first-come, first-served and provide picnic tables, hearth rings and close by pit restrooms.

It presents guests alternatives for mountaineering, biking, fishing and sightseeing. Campers may try the close by trailhead to Tamanawas Falls, which gives a family-friendly hike for all ages.

Nottingham Campground is open from May 1 to Sept. 15, and nightly charges start at $28.56. It obtained 4.72 out of 5 stars based mostly on 18 camper critiques in 2025 and was most appreciated for its stunning and quiet location, in accordance with Camp Chimp.

6. Union Creek

Union Creek campground is situated 18 miles south of Baker City within the Wallowa Whitman National Forest. Camp Chimp described as “popular but excellent.”

The campground options three loops with 60 campsites that every have a picnic desk and grill, close by consuming water and handicap-accessible restrooms with flushing bogs.

While tenting, guests can discover Phillips Reservoir for views of the Elkhorn Mountains and blooming spring wildflowers. There can be a rocky seashore for swimming and a ship launch.

Union Creek is open from May 15 to Sept. 30, and nightly charges start at $36. It obtained 4.74 out of 5 stars based mostly on 43 camper critiques in 2025, in accordance with Camp Chimp.

5. Tahkenitch Landing

Tahkenitch Landing is situated close to Gardiner within the Siuslaw National Forest and alongside the shores of Tahkenitch Lake.

The campground options 15 campsites with picnic tables and hearth rings, together with on-site vault restrooms. It is discovered inside Oregon Dunes National Recreation Area and alongside the shores of Tahkenitch Lake, providing alternatives for mountaineering, swimming, boating and fishing.

Tahkenitch Landing is open from Feb. 11 to Dec. 31 and nightly charges start at $22. It obtained 4.8 out of 5 stars based mostly on 15 camper critiques that mentioned the campground was “clean and friendly” in 2025, in accordance with Camp Chimp.

4. Bull Prairie

Bull Prairie campground is situated close to Heppner.

Campers reportedly loved the “high quality” of the campground, which presents 28 tent and RV campsites, two tent-only campsites, three double campsites and one group campsite. It is situated subsequent to Bull Prairie Lake, which is stocked yearly with trout and contains a boat ramp dock and a trailer parking space.

Visitors can get pleasure from fishing, swimming, picnicking and morning walks alongside the paved highway that runs via the campground.

Bull Prairie is open from May 8 to Oct. 18, and nightly charges start at $14. It obtained 4.8 out of 5 stars based mostly on 54 camper critiques in 2025, in accordance with Camp Chimp.

3. Gorge Campground

Gorge Campground close to Camp Sherman is a part of a bunch of campgrounds discovered alongside the higher portion of the Metolius River.

Campers most appreciated the campground’s location and peaceable setting. It presents 17 tenting websites geared up with picnic tables, campfire rings and grills. There are vaulted restrooms, however no potable water. Visitors can get pleasure from fishing and mountaineering alternatives alongside the Metolius River.

Gorge Campground is open from May 15 to Sept. 26, and nightly charges start at $27. It obtained 4.83 out of 5 stars based mostly on 12 camper critiques in 2025, in accordance with Camp Chimp.

2. House Rock

House Rock Campground is situated close to Sweet Home within the Willamette National Forest.

Campers appreciated the campground’s well-maintained websites and exquisite views. It has an higher and decrease loop that gives 17 campsites, three restrooms, and two hand pumps for consuming water. Visitors can discover picnic tables, grills and campfire rings at every website.

The 0.8-mile Horse Rock Trail is close by, as is Sheep Creek and the South Santiam River, offering campers with alternatives for mountaineering, swimming, fishing and sightseeing.

House Rock is open from May 1 to Sept. 26, and nightly charges start at $25. House Rock Campground obtained 4.85 out of 5 stars based mostly on 13 camper critiques in 2025, in accordance with Camp Chimp.

1. Horseshoe Bend Campground

Horseshoe Bend is a campground discovered within the Umpqua National Forest.

Campers loved its peaceable environment, useful tenting hosts and clear services. The campground gives potable water, restrooms with flushing bogs, hand-washing sinks, paved roads, trash bins and an on-site camp host. It has 25 reservable campsites with picnic tables, hearth rings and a few barbecue grills.

The campground additionally presents alternatives for out of doors actions like mountaineering, fly fishing, nature pictures, mountain biking, birding, swimming and whitewater rafting.

The tenting season is open from May 23 to Sept. 21, and nightly charges start at $20. Horseshoe Bend obtained 4.87 out of 5 stars based mostly on 15 camper critiques in 2025, in accordance with Camp Chimp.
